应用审核期间应用内购买失败

3
我有以下问题:我已经在我的应用程序中添加了应用内购买功能,并按照苹果公司的建议进行了测试(我使用了我的自己和沙盒账户,使用测试版分发版本),一切都正常。 然而,在苹果公司的应用程序审核期间测试这些应用内购买时,SKPaymentTransaction会出现以下错误:

code=0 "无法连接到iTunes商店。 UserInfo={NSLoalizedDesciption=无法连接到iTunes Store}"

这是什么原因导致的呢?

据我所见,所有这些要求都得到满足,并且根据您提供的链接,问题不仅出现在审核阶段,而且在开发阶段也存在。在我的情况下,即使是测试版也可以正常工作,但只有在苹果审核期间才无法正常工作。 - Anton
1个回答

3

你需要等待几个小时才能在生产环境中购买应用内购买 (沙盒环境有所不同)。

我认为苹果不会在沙盒环境中审核应用,所以这可能是预期的行为。或者,在购买应用内购买时抛出错误可能是审核流程的一部分。

在我的看法中,如果在沙盒环境中一切正常,你就不必担心生产环境 (我真的认为这只是小小的延迟问题)。


的确,它开始适用于苹果应用商店的评论。但是在创建应用内购买和审核期间,它花费了不止几个小时,而是超过一周的时间才开始运行。 - Anton

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接